ChanServ changed the topic of #aarch64-laptops to: Linux support for AArch64 Laptops (Chrome OS Trogdor Devices - Asus NovaGo TP370QL - HP Envy x2 - Lenovo Mixx 630 - Lenovo Yoga C630 - Lenovo ThinkPad X13s - and various other snapdragon laptops) - https://oftc.irclog.whitequark.org/aarch64-laptops
laine has quit [Quit: (╯°□°)╯︵ ┻━┻]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
kbingham[m] has quit [Quit: Reconnecting]
kbingham[m] has joined #aarch64-laptops
weirdtreething has quit [Ping timeout: 480 seconds]
weirdtreething has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<clover[m]> Yay my dev kit came in today!
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
tobhe_ has joined #aarch64-laptops
tobhe has quit [Ping timeout: 480 seconds]
hexdump0815 has joined #aarch64-laptops
hexdump01 has quit [Ping timeout: 480 seconds]
KREYREN_oftc has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
sally has quit []
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
sally has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
eluks has quit [Remote host closed the connection]
eluks has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
SpieringsAE has joined #aarch64-laptops
<SpieringsAE> clover: what kind of devkit? You got a second hand snapdragon devkit?
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
sally has quit [Quit: ZNC 1.10.1 - https://znc.in]
sally has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
KREYREN_oftc has quit [Ping timeout: 480 seconds]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
icecream95 has joined #aarch64-laptops
<icecream95> robclark: Do you know why Freedreno's storage_8bit setting doesn't work on X1-85, when the Windows driver does expose VK_KHR_8bit_storage?
chrisl has joined #aarch64-laptops
<icecream95> Does the blob just emulate the feature using 16-bit operations, or do GPUs older than a7xx_gen3 have a different way of encoding 8-bit instructions?
<icecream95> (I've written a SPIRV-Tools opt pass which can emulate it in some cases, but am wondering whether I didn't need to bother.)
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
ungeskriptet has quit [Remote host closed the connection]
ungeskriptet has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
ungeskriptet has quit [Remote host closed the connection]
ungeskriptet has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
ravikant_ has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
leezu has joined #aarch64-laptops
wizzard has joined #aarch64-laptops
<robclark> icecream95: hmm, we thought that was new in a750.. but I can double check. You could try setting `storage_8bit = True` in freedreno_devices.py and see if the deqp tests pass?
chrisl has quit [Ping timeout: 480 seconds]
<icecream95> robclark: I haven't tried with deqp, but if I set that then 8-bit instructions seem to still be 16-bit... or at least the offset is still shifted left one bit
<robclark> maybe blob emulates it somehow, I guess?
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<icecream95> I wonder if the compiler should check if 8-bit loads/stores are being used when it won't work, because otherwise applications not checking the feature bit looks like miscompilation
chrisl has joined #aarch64-laptops
<robclark> I guess in theory validation layers would check that (but not sure if they do much spirv checking)
<leezu> jglathe: have you tried installing linux alongside windows as in the chenguokai/tutorial-dev-kit-linux.md linked in your linux_ms_dev_kit repo? If I read your comments on Github right you usually install to external disk? I've got at 1TB Lenovo Ideapad 5 2-in-1 14Q8X9 (83GH) and curious to hear if you have any suggestions. I'm also wondering how you built your
<leezu> Ubuntu_Desktop_24.10_Lenovo_Ideapad_5_2in1_6.16rc.img.xz. I assume you take upstream image and add kernel and dtbs? Anything else?
ungeskriptet has quit [Remote host closed the connection]
ungeskriptet has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<icecream95> robclark: I guess I should have thought of that earlier... "SPIR-V contains an 8-bit OpVariable with StorageBuffer Storage Class, but storageBuffer8BitAccess was not enabled."
<icecream95> Thanks for the reminder that validation layers are a thing...
<robclark> heheh, np
chrisl has joined #aarch64-laptops
icecream95 has quit [Quit: rcirc on GNU Emacs 29.1]
chrisl has quit [Ping timeout: 480 seconds]
<JensGlathe[m]> leezu: All devices here have an install alongside Windows, only one from the Ubuntu Concept ISO. The image I use is for first bringup outside of the ISO, still fighting with the toolchain from time to time. I have an Ideapad 5 83GH (512GB) too, with manual install alongside Windows. Got sound activated there, still wrestling with the OLED display a bit.
<JensGlathe[m]> I took the pre-installed desktop image for raspi and derived from there, many moons ago. Would need to redo for 25.10 (I guess) but hesitant to do so because its tedious. The only way for a real installer would be an ISO because they use Casper.
<JensGlathe[m]> There will be a new image for the 83GH this weekend, I guess. And a wiki documentation on how to install on the local nvme.
chrisl has joined #aarch64-laptops
<JensGlathe[m]> If you want to help: Can you provide the hwinfo64 log for your device? A dmesg and lsusb might be useful after the new Image is up.
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
erebion_muc has quit [Quit: Gateway shutdown]
Lenni has quit [Quit: Gateway shutdown]
erebion_muc has joined #aarch64-laptops
Lenni has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
KREYREN_oftc has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
KREYREN_oftc has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
SpieringsAE has quit [Quit: SpieringsAE]
chrisl has quit [Ping timeout: 480 seconds]
akaWolf has quit [Read error: Connection reset by peer]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
<leezu> jglathe: Wiki documentation on install to local nvme, incl. alongside windows would be very helpful. I currently run something similar to https://github.com/velvet-os/velvet-os.github.io/blob/main/install-to-emmc-with-luks-full-disk-encryption.txt on a sc7180 chromebook, so plan to try get a similar setup working on the 83GH.
<leezu> Will share the hwinfo64 logs later today
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<\[m]> > FEX only has to translate x86 Windows code; WINE calls out to native AArch64 64-bit Windows and *nix
chrisl has joined #aarch64-laptops
<HdkR> arm64ec/wow64 is powerful indeed.
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<leezu> jglathe: please see the hwinfo log at https://pastebin.com/YgFN2KnC It seems your current image does not boot (F12 and select the usb drive still brought up windows).
ravikant_ has quit [Remote host closed the connection]
ravikant_ has joined #aarch64-laptops
ravikant_ has quit []
<clover[m]> SpieringsAE:
<clover[m]> Yeah, it's a used project volterra devkit. Its like a x13s in a mac mini / intel nuc form factor
<clover[m]> I will probably end up following Jens Glathe's kernel, but gonna try putting arch on it 😉
<JensGlathe[m]> , btw
mike_lok has joined #aarch64-laptops
<mike_lok> Hello, can you please tell me which steps I need to follow in order to enable microphone + internal speakers + webcam on my Dell XPS 9345 - running Kubuntu 25.04 with 6.16.0-12-qcom-x1 at the moment, but I have no idea how to add the patches from alexVinarskis. Looking forward to your help :-)
mike_lok has quit [Remote host closed the connection]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
valpackett_ has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
valpackett_ has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
mjeanson has quit [Read error: No route to host]
mjeanson has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
mjeanson has quit [Read error: Connection reset by peer]
mjeanson has joined #aarch64-laptops
mjeanson has quit [Read error: Connection reset by peer]
chrisl has joined #aarch64-laptops
mjeanson has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
mjeanson has quit [Read error: Connection reset by peer]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
mjeanson has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
mjeanson has quit [Remote host closed the connection]
chrisl has joined #aarch64-laptops
mjeanson has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
mjeanson has quit [Read error: Connection reset by peer]
mjeanson has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
Ariadne has quit [Remote host closed the connection]
Ariadne has joined #aarch64-laptops
Ariadne has quit [Remote host closed the connection]
Ariadne has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]